The Heisman Trophy: A Defining Moment
His college career reached its zenith in 1987 when he was awarded the Heisman Trophy, college football's most prestigious individual honor. This accolade wasn't just a personal achievement; it was a recognition of his exceptional talent, his unwavering commitment to his team, and his impact on the sport. Winning the Heisman Trophy catapulted him into the national spotlight and solidified his status as one of the most promising young players in the country. It was a moment of immense pride for Brown, his family, and the entire Notre Dame community. This award not only marked the pinnacle of his college career but also served as a launching pad for his entry into the NFL.

NFL Career: A Raider Legend
In 1988, Tim Brown embarked on his NFL journey when he was drafted by the Los Angeles Raiders with the sixth overall pick. Joining the Raiders marked the beginning of a legendary career that would span 17 seasons and solidify his place among the NFL's all-time greats. From the moment he stepped onto the field in the silver and black, it was clear that he was destined for greatness.

Hall of Fame Induction
In 2015, Tim Brown received the ultimate honor when he was inducted into the Pro Football Hall of Fame. This recognition was a testament to his exceptional career and his lasting impact on the sport. His induction was a moment of immense pride for him, his family, the Raiders organization, and the Notre Dame community. It was a celebration of his remarkable journey and a recognition of his place among the legends of the game. He truly earned his spot among the greats.
